The pilates training method was created by Joseph Pilates and has been used by students and teachers for well over 60 years.

He drew a great deal of his understanding from eastern philosophies and their teachings, such as Yoga, Martial Arts, and the Feldenkreis method of breathing.

His technique is now used by most major ballet companies and ballet schools as well as professional athletes, who use the technique for remedial and injury prevention work.

Pilates teaches:

Pilates teaches awareness of movement pattern, and with the tools of that awareness you can change bad muscular behaviour which causes discomfort. You will be able to change your body to new and better muscular pattern and learn to live and exercise without discomfort. These patterns include:

  • Breathing
  • Integrating the ribcage and shoulder girdle
  • Neutral alignment by maintaining the natural spine
  • Pelvic stability

Pilates exercises do not produce force on any ligaments, tendons and/or joints.

CAROLYN BAILEY
PHYSIOTHERAPIST & PILATES INSTRUCTOR


Carolyn has 11 years experience as a physiotherapist, and came across Pilates when she was School Physio for the Central School of Ballet in London. She then combined her Pilates training with her physio experience to create a holistic approach to rehabilitation. Carolyn’s expertise is tracing the source of pain and injury and correcting movement dysfunction, joining forces with her client in an active treatment plan.

AVA KATICS
PHYSIOTHERAPIST

A Sheffielder by birth, Ava’s work has taken her all over the world, in roles as diverse as advising on puppet movement at the National Theatre, to working with professional sportsmen and women, actors, musicians and dancers.

A Chartered and State Registered Physiotherapist, Ava has both a Degree and Post-Graduate qualifications in Physiotherapy. She spent seven years working in the NHS before moving into private practice. Ava has also spent ten years specialising in the treatment of professional dancers, with an emphasis on the prevention of injury and performance enhancement.

Ava’s core belief is that Physiotherapy can benefit everyone, from housewife to elite sportsman, and from firefighter to professional dancer.
